3. Liabilities
Liabilities represent financial obligations owed by Shayanna Jenkins. These obligations directly impact the calculation of net worth by reducing the overall value. A detailed understanding of liabilities is essential for a complete picture of her financial standing. The nature and extent of these obligations play a significant role in determining her net worth.
- Types of Liabilities
Liabilities encompass various forms of debt, including loans (mortgages, car loans, personal loans), credit card debt, outstanding invoices, and other financial commitments. Accrued expenses and taxes also constitute liabilities. A comprehensive analysis of the various categories of debt provides a more nuanced understanding of the financial obligations impacting her net worth.
- Impact on Net Worth
Liabilities directly reduce net worth. The principal amount of a loan, coupled with accumulated interest, represents a financial obligation that decreases the overall net worth. High levels of liabilities can constrain financial flexibility and affect the ability to invest or generate income. The ongoing costs of maintaining these liabilities (interest payments, for instance) further erode potential returns and available funds. Understanding the impact of liabilities is critical for evaluating an individual's net worth.
- Valuation and Management
Accurate valuation of liabilities is essential for determining net worth. The current market value of assets and corresponding liabilities must be considered. Effective management of liabilities is critical. This entails making timely payments, negotiating terms for favorable repayment, and establishing a plan for reducing debt. Strategies for managing liabilities can significantly affect an individual's financial health, ultimately affecting their net worth.
- Relationship to Income
The relationship between liabilities and income is crucial. High liabilities in comparison to income can negatively impact financial stability. The ability to cover debt obligations using available income directly impacts the potential for asset accumulation and overall financial well-being. This relationship underscores the importance of managing debts responsibly to maintain financial stability and improve net worth.

4. Investments
Investment decisions significantly influence an individual's net worth. The returns, or lack thereof, from various investment strategies directly impact the overall financial standing. Understanding how investments function in relation to net worth is crucial for evaluating financial health.
- Types of Investments
Different investment avenues, including stocks, bonds, real estate, and other ventures, possess varying degrees of risk and potential return. The allocation of capital across these different asset classes plays a vital role in portfolio diversification. Investments in shares of publicly traded companies, for instance, present opportunities for growth but carry market risk. Bonds, on the other hand, offer a more stable return but carry less potential for significant appreciation. The choices regarding investment types reflect a strategic approach to risk management.
- Investment Returns and Growth
Investment returns directly contribute to overall net worth. High returns on investments translate into increased asset value, bolstering net worth. Conversely, poor returns or losses diminish net worth. Investment performance, influenced by market conditions and individual choices, directly affects the size of an individual's financial portfolio. Growth in investment value, through capital appreciation or dividends, contributes significantly to increases in overall net worth.
- Diversification and Risk Management
Diversifying investments across different asset classes mitigates risk. A well-diversified portfolio reduces the impact of losses in one area on the entire investment strategy. A comprehensive portfolio strategy often helps investors maintain financial stability during market fluctuations. This risk management approach is essential for sustaining and increasing net worth over time.
- Investment Strategy and Goals
Investment strategies align with individual financial goals. Strategies for accumulating wealth for retirement, for instance, necessitate a different approach than those aiming for short-term gains. Individual objectives and risk tolerances directly influence investment choices. A well-defined investment strategy is therefore fundamental in achieving financial goals, ultimately impacting an individual's net worth.
